Payments: fast in, competent out, verification first
Deposits are effectively instant across cards, e-wallets and crypto. Withdrawals are processed competently once the account is verified — e-wallets and crypto typically within a day of approval, cards within a few banking days. The recurring complaint in player forums is not refusal but delay on first withdrawals, and in most documented cases the cause is unverified accounts or third-party payment attempts. Verify early and the experience is unremarkable, which is the highest compliment a casino cashier can earn. Details sit on the payment methods page.

Reading reviews like an editor
Apply these tests to any casino review you find, ours included. Does the reviewer name specific, checkable facts — game counts, licence details, processing times — or only adjectives? Are the negatives described with the same confidence as the positives, or is the «cons» section a token paragraph? Does the page disclose that it earns commission on sign-ups (most do, this portal included — judge the content anyway)? And is there a date? A glowing 2023 review quoting a bonus that no longer exists is worse than useless.
